This site is intended as an archive to chronicle the history of Alternate Reality Games.

The key for this is
Spoiler (Rollover to View):
Chapter, word, letter. 1.24.4 means chapter 1, word 24, thenthe 4th letter of that word. Start counting words after the words ''Chapter XXX'' which means even the location name are counted as words.


The answer should be (and if doesnt really make sense, unless any of you got an idea)
Spoiler (Rollover to View):
Sand reckoner. On the 39 clues book puzzle answer box, had to put it in as one word with no spacing as answer for it to be accepted.
